路由器故障:下行设备无法学习到等值路由
创始人
2024-07-25 13:00:29
0

默认路由Metric值偏大导致下行设备无法学习到等值路由的故障的解决如下:

网络环境

RouterA、RouterB、RouterC之间建立OSPF连接。RouterB和RouterC各自发送一条默认路由给RouterA,但是在RouterA上只能学习到RouterB发送的默认路由,而学习不到RouterC发送的默认路由。

图默认路由Metric值偏大导致下行设备无法学习到等值路由

路由器故障:下行设备无法学习到等值路由

故障分析

1.         在RouterA上查询OSPF LSDB信息,确定RouterC发布的默认路由LSA在RouterA上是否已经收到。

2.         如果RouterA的LSDB中有RouterC发布过来的默认路由表项,则分析RouterA的路由表中为什么没有该条目。

3.         如果RouterA的LSDB中没有RouterC发布过来的默认路由表项,则分析RouterC没有发送或者RouterA没有接收到该默认路由条目的原因。

操作步骤

步骤 1     执行命令display ospf lsdb命令查看RouterA的LSDB信息。

由RouterC发布的默认路由(AdvRouter为X.X.0.66的条目)RouterA上已经存在。

Type LinkState ID        AdvRouter   Age   Len    Sequence      Metric       Where         ASE  0.0.0.0             X.X.0.66    230    36    0x80000012      2      Uninitialized
ASE  0.0.0.0             X.X.X.99    1195   36    0x8000c91e      1      Uninitialized

步骤 2     分析RouterA的路由表中没有该表项的原因是RouterC(X.X.0.66)发布的默认路由的Metric值为2,而RouterB(X.X.X.20)通过命令default-route-advertise always type 2 cost 1发布的默认路由的Metric值为1,所以RouterA依据路由计算原则优先选择RouterB发布的默认路由。

步骤 3     执行命令default-route-advertise always type 2 cost 1调整RouterC发布默认路由的Metric值。

步骤 4     保存配置。

RouterA的路由表中存在由RouterC发布的的默认路由表项,则故障被排除。

----结束

案例总结

当在路由器的路由表中,发现有路由表项缺失的情况时,应及时检查所缺失路由表项的Metric值设置是否正确。

【编辑推荐】

  1. 路由器故障:A个平面业务中断
  2. 路由器故障:OSPF路由选路失败
  3. 路由器故障:静态ARP配置不生效
  4. 路由器故障:路由引入错误导致用户上网异常

相关内容

热门资讯

如何允许远程连接到MySQL数... [[277004]]【51CTO.com快译】默认情况下,MySQL服务器仅侦听来自localhos...
如何利用交换机和端口设置来管理... 在网络管理中,总是有些人让管理员头疼。下面我们就将介绍一下一个网管员利用交换机以及端口设置等来进行D...
施耐德电气数据中心整体解决方案... 近日,全球能效管理专家施耐德电气正式启动大型体验活动“能效中国行——2012卡车巡展”,作为该活动的...
20个非常棒的扁平设计免费资源 Apple设备的平面图标PSD免费平板UI 平板UI套件24平图标Freen平板UI套件PSD径向平...
Windows恶意软件20年“... 在Windows的早期年代,病毒游走于系统之间,偶尔删除文件(但被删除的文件几乎都是可恢复的),并弹...
德国电信门户网站可实时显示全球... 德国电信周三推出一个门户网站,直观地实时提供其安装在全球各地的传感器网络检测到的网络攻击状况。该网站...
为啥国人偏爱 Mybatis,... 关于 SQL 和 ORM 的争论,永远都不会终止,我也一直在思考这个问题。昨天又跟群里的小伙伴进行...
《非诚勿扰》红人闫凤娇被曝厕所... 【51CTO.com 综合消息360安全专家提醒说,“闫凤娇”、“非诚勿扰”已经被黑客盯上成为了“木...